ABSTRACT:
Changing the ways your company uses digital technology can quickly make your business more ecofriendly and efficient. Smart IT practices reduce carbon emissions and the consumption of valuable resources--including space and energy.
When you transcend the eco-hype and actually do digital differently, your company also reduces capital expenses, energy bills, and other operational expenses--savings that can help build the business, and your career.
Doing IT differently is good for the environment, and good for your business. It's also a goal that you can pursue incrementally.
Answer these questions to determine how eco-friendly your IT is.
